ORDER OF CONFIRMATION
OF THIRD AMENDED PLAN OF REORGANIZATION

The Third Amended Plan of Reorganization of Gasel Transportation Lines, Inc., came before this court for hearing on Confirmation (the "Confirmation Hearing") after notice to all parties n, interest_

The court having considered the acceptances and rejections of the Plan pursuant to LBR 3018-2(b), the Court's review of the Amended Plan, the evidence, the representations of counsel at the Confirrnatioui Hearing, the record of ballots accepting or rejecting the Plan, the withdrawals of objection to Confirmation and the undisputed record at the Confirmation Hearing, hereby makes the following finding of facts and conclusions of law:

1.       The following recluirements for confirmation set forth in 11 U.S.C. § 1129(a) have been fully satisfied and the Plan shall be confirmed:

a.         the Plan complies with the applicable provisions of the Bankruptcy code;

b,         the proponent of the Plan has complied with the applicable provisions of

the Bankruptcy Code;

c.         the Plan has been proposed in good faith and not by any means forbidden by law;

d.         notice of the tune for filing objections to confirmation and the hearing on confirmation was given in accordance with PRBP 2002(b)(2), adequate notice and service of an opportunity to be heard on the Plan and all transactions proposed thereunder was given to all creditors, the form and scope of notice were appropriate under the circumstances, and all parties in interest had an adequate opportunity to appear and be heard at the hearing;

e.                   the procedure by which ballots for acceptance or rejection of the Plan were distributed and tabulated, were fair and were properly conducted;

f.          the flan does not unfairly discriminate and is fair and equitable with respect to any classes not accepting the Plan;

L",       an unpaired class of creditors has accepted the Plan by more than fifty percent (50`%n) in number and sixty-six and two-thirds percent (66-2/3%) in dollar amount of the ballot cast;

Confirmation of Plan is not likely to be followed by the liquidation of the property of the Debtor, or further financial reorgazlization of the Debtor; all fees payable under Section 1930 of the Judicial Code, 28 U.S.C. 1930,
